Following a major Houthi missile and drone offensive on September 8, 2026, that wounded 73 people and struck Saudi Aramco facilities, Pakistan delivered a warning from Riyadh to Tehran to rein in its Yemeni allies. While Pakistan's Defence Minister Khawaja Asif warned that the newly signed Mecca Joint Defence Agreement could be activated to defend Saudi territory, Pakistan's foreign ministry clarified that no immediate military response is under discussion. Meanwhile, Saudi forces retaliated with dozens of airstrikes as the Houthis captured the strategic port city of Mocha.
